Benefits of Routine Periodontist Visits



Regular check outs to a periodontist can considerably improve your oral health and wellness and avoid prospective problems. By scheduling routine visits with a periodontist, you're taking positive actions in the direction of keeping a healthy and balanced smile.

One of the essential advantages of these sees is the early detection of gum disease. A periodontist is specially educated to determine signs of gum condition, such as bleeding periodontals, halitosis, and gum economic crisis. Catching gum tissue illness in its onset allows for prompt therapy, avoiding further damage to your gum tissues and teeth.

Furthermore, routine periodontist brows through make sure that your oral hygiene routine is effective. The periodontist can give individualized guidance on proper cleaning and flossing techniques, along with recommend any kind of necessary changes to your oral hygiene regimen.

Common Indications of Periodontal Issues



If you're experiencing any of the adhering to symptoms, it is very important to be conscious that they may be indications of periodontal problems.

One of the most typical indications is consistent bad breath or a negative preference in your mouth. This can be brought on by the build-up of germs in your gums and can suggest the presence of gum disease.

One more sign to look out for is gum tissues that are red, puffy, or tender. Healthy gum tissues must be pink and company, so any kind of changes in their look or appearance might indicate a problem.

Additionally, if you observe that your gums hemorrhage when you clean or floss, maybe a sign of gum tissue disease.

Finally, loose or shifting teeth can additionally signify periodontal issues and shouldn't be overlooked.

If you experience any one of these symptoms, it's critical to seek specialist assistance from a periodontist to prevent more damage to your dental health.

Therapy Options for Gum Conditions



If you have actually noticed any kind of indicators of gum tissue disease, it's important to recognize the available treatment options. Here are four common therapy choices for gum tissue diseases:

1. ** Scaling and Origin Planing **: This non-surgical procedure involves getting rid of plaque and tartar from the teeth and root surfaces, raveling rough locations to stop microorganisms buildup.

2. ** Antibiotics **: In many cases, antibiotics might be prescribed to manage microbial infection and decrease inflammation.

3. ** Gum Surgical Treatment **: Advanced cases of gum condition might need medical intervention, such as flap surgical procedure or bone grafting, to fix damaged tissues and bring back gum health and wellness.

4. ** Laser Therapy **: This minimally intrusive treatment utilizes laser technology to eliminate contaminated tissue and promote gum regrowth.
